A member asked:

I'm 49missed two periods took hpt neg are blood test better results?

See GYN: At 49, unless your having unprotected sex, and think you may be pregnant, you may be starting menopause. The upt's are very sensitive and almost as good as a blood test for hcg, however if you see your gyn, that would most likely be included in blood tests for menopause as well. Best wishes.

Hpts very reliable: Blood test can measure pregnancy hormone levels and detect lower levels than hpts. You are most likely perimenopausal and beginning to ovulate less frequently. The home test is likely reliable and would not require checking a blood test.
